Job Description

Roles & Responsibilities

Telehealth physiotherapy : Provide specialized trauma-focused physiotherapy to survivors of torture, sexual and gender-based violence and other gross human rights violations. Conduct comprehensive assessments of needs and risk factors. Use appropriate evidence-based clinical interventions informed by a treatment plan. Conduct follow-up assessments. Securely keep accurate clinical records of all activities.

Training : Actively participate in orientation and trainings on CVT s Trauma-focused Physiotherapy and Telehealth approaches to client care.

Client Documentation : Complete comprehensive intake assessment and subsequent SOAP notes and follow-up evaluations on Electronic health Records system. Document any community referrals and contact information.

Team Collaboration : Participate in clinical supervision, case consultations, and peer consultations as needed.

Other Duties : Complete administrative responsibilities. Perform other duties as assigned.
